The Role of a Lung Specialist

A lung specialist, also known as a pulmonologist, is a physician who specializes in the diagnosis and treatment of conditions related to the lungs and respiratory system. Here are some key responsibilities:

  • Diagnosing respiratory diseases such as asthma, COPD, pneumonia, and lung cancer.
  • Conducting diagnostic tests including pulmonary function tests, chest X-rays, and CT scans.
  • Developing treatment plans that may include medication, therapy, or recommendations for surgery.
  • Monitoring chronic conditions and adjusting treatment plans as necessary.
  • Providing education and support to patients and their families.

Common Respiratory Conditions Treated by Lung Specialists

In Singapore, lung specialists address a variety of respiratory conditions, understanding that each patient has unique needs. Here are some common conditions that they treat:

  1. Asthma: This chronic condition affects the airways, leading to wheezing, shortness of breath, and coughing.
  2.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D): A progressive illness that obstructs airflow and causes breathing difficulties.
  3. Pneumonia: An infection that inflates the air sacs in one or both lungs, resulting in cough and fever.
  4. Pulmonary Fibrosis: A disease that results in scarring of the lung tissue, leading to breathing difficulties.
  5. Lung Cancer: A deadly form of cancer that requires prompt diagnosis and treatment.

Innovative Treatments Available in Singapore

Singapore is at the forefront of medical innovation, particularly in the field of respiratory medicine. Here are some advanced treatment options offered by lung specialists:

  • Bronchoscopy: A minimally invasive procedure used for diagnosis and treatment, allowing direct visualization of the airways.
  • pulmonary rehabilitation: A comprehensive program designed to improve the physical and emotional conditions of patients with chronic respiratory diseases.
  • Biologic therapies: Advanced medications that target specific pathways in diseases like asthma and COPD.
  • Lung transplantation: Reserved for patients with end-stage lung disease, featuring rigorous selection processes and post-operative care.
  • Telemedicine: Remote consultations that provide convenient access to specialists, especially beneficial for follow-ups.

The Importance of Preventive Care

Preventive care is vital in maintaining lung health. Lung specialists advocate for regular screenings and healthy lifestyle choices, which include:

  • Avoiding Smoking: The leading cause of lung disease; quitting smoking drastically reduces risks.
  • Maintaining a Healthy Lifestyle: Regular exercise and a balanced diet can improve lung function and overall health.
  • Vaccinations: Getting vaccinated against pneumonia and influenza can prevent serious respiratory infections.
  • Environmental Awareness: Minimizing exposure to pollutants and allergens can protect lung health.
  • Regular Check-ups: Regular visits to a specialist can catch potential issues before they become severe.
